Presidency Dismisses Babachir Lawal’s Claim of Peter Obi’s 2023 Election Victory

The Presidency has rejected claims by former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F), Babachir Lawal, that Labour Party (LP) presidential candidate, Peter Obi, won the 2023 presidential election.
In a televised interview with Channels TV, Lawal alleged that Obi defeated President Ahmed Bola Tinubu, but the results were altered. The statement has stirred political debate and reactions on social media.
Responding via his official X account, Sunday Dare, Senior Special Adviser on Public Communication to President Tinubu, described Lawal’s assertion as false.
“Your claim that Peter Obi won the 2023 elections is not only egregious but a barefaced lie. The people have spoken, the law has sanctioned it,” Dare said.
He noted that the election results were challenged in court, but the judiciary upheld Tinubu’s victory, confirming the legitimacy of the process.
The Presidency reiterated its position that the 2023 election outcome was legally validated and warned against spreading unverified claims that could undermine public trust in democratic institutions.
